Machine Learning Based Approach To Identify The Positive Traits Of A Successful Entrepreneur

Abstract: Machine learning based approach to identify the positive traits of a successful entrepreneur is the proposed invention. The invention aims at pointing out the important aspects that are required to guide an entrepreneur. The algorithm s of machine learning such as predictive and decision tree algorithms are used to analyze the traits of a successful entrepreneur.

Claims:1. Machine learning based approach to identify the positive traits of a successful entrepreneur comprises of
database of entrepreneurs;
resultant unit;
cloud server;
machine learning unit and
prediction unit.
2. Machine learning based approach to identify the positive traits of a successful entrepreneur, according to claim 1, includes a database of entrepreneurs, wherein the database will include data related to the entrepreneurs.
3. Machine learning based approach to identify the positive traits of a successful entrepreneur, according to claim 1, includes a resultant unit, wherein the resultant unit will store results pointing out the factors responsible for successful entrepreneur.
4. Machine learning based approach to identify the positive traits of a successful entrepreneur, according to claim 1, includes a cloud server, wherein the cloud server will monitor the database and establishes coordination among various components of the proposed invention.
5. Machine learning based approach to identify the positive traits of a successful entrepreneur, according to claim 1, includes a machine learning unit, wherein the machine learning unit will train the module to identify the positive traits of an entrepreneur.
6. Machine learning based approach to identify the positive traits of a successful entrepreneur, according to claim 1, includes a prediction unit, wherein the prediction unit will predict the characteristics of successful entrepreneur.

[0017] An entrepreneur is a person who organizes and operates a business venture and assumes much of the associated risks. Entrepreneurship is the ability and readiness to develop, organize and run a business enterprise, along with any of its uncertainties in order to make a profit.
[0018] Management skills and strong team building abilities are often perceived as essential leadership attributes for successful entrepreneurs. The entrepreneur must be willing to put his or her career and financial security on the line and take risks in the name of idea, spending time as well as capital on an uncertain venture. The proposed invention implements the algorithms of machine learning to identify the positive traits of a successful entrepreneur.

[0020] Figure 1 illustrates the block diagram of machine learning based approach to identify the positive traits of a successful entrepreneur 100. The proposed system 100 includes database of entrepreneurs 101 to be fed into machine learning unit 102 as input. The output of machine learning unit is analyzed by predictive unit 103 and results are stored on resultant unit 104. All are communications and coordination’s take place over the cloud server 105.
